Video poker is one of the hottest games to
hit the casino floor! Flashing screens entice players to try their
luck at drawing winning card combinations. Although most people
believe winning is merely a matter of hit or miss, there is actually
more to mastering these machines than the luck of the draw. Until
now, little information has been available for those looking to
maximize their winnings. Author Linda Boyd has written The
Video Poker Edge--a detailed, user-friendly guide to help
both the novice and the experienced player gain the winning edge
over video poker machines.
The Video Poker Edge begins by
explaining the basics of video poker. It then presents sound mathematical
strategies tailored to each game's specific probability. In addition
to sharing groundbreaking information on the latest technological
devices--including controversial video lottery terminals--Boyd reveals
which casinos have machines with the best payback percentages. Throughout
the book, full-color illustrations clarify the recommended tactics
for various card hands. As an added bonus, the author has included
handy strategy cards with valuable tips. These cards can be removed
from the book and taken along to the casino for reference during
play.

Linda
Boyd spent many years as a mathematics educator--a career
that proved valuable in helping her design the statistical tactics
included in this book, and present them in a way that is easy to
understand even for the "mathematically challenged." After years
of playing blackjack and live poker, Ms. Boyd turned to the more
profitable game of video poker.
